Samsung is preparing to re enter the camera enabled appliance market with a dual camera doorbell, based on a new design patent spotted at the Korean Intellectual Property office. The patent images show a wide, vertically oriented rectangle design primarily consisting of two speakers, a dual camera sensor array, and display embedded behind glass. An apparent capacitive button with a glowing bell icon is included in the metal frame just below that and the frame extends around the entire doorbell. Viewed from the top, the back half of the doorbell is flat to sit flush with a wall or door frame. The front side is flat along the top and bottom edge but has curves similar to the company's Galaxy S series flagships at the left and right hand edge. No indication is given with regard to scale but, based on the size of the camera sensors in relation to the overall size of the doorbell, it wouldn't likely be much larger than a few inches wide. Background: Samsung has had at least some experience in the category of camera enabled doorbells and similar technologies thanks in part to former subsidiary Hanwha Techwin and its SmartCam lineup. However, it has been quite some time since any new products were launched under the Samsung branding. Finalization of the sale of Samsung Techwin to Hanwha Group was completed in 2015, with the newly merged company rebranding as Hanwha Techwin. The Korean tech giant's efforts in the space since that split have been almost entirely non existent. Hanwha Techwin has gone on to continue making cameras and still utilizes Samsung's SmartCam and WiseNet branding as well as online services for the storage and subscription services side of the business.
